[dropcap]A[/dropcap]bout a week ago, I got a phone call from Matt’s dad saying that he was helping his son plan the proposal of a lifetime. At the time, I was unsure that I’d have the day available, but after hearing all about Matt’s epic plan to propose to Jess, I knew I had to be a part of it.

Matt is graduating from WVU School of Law this year and he told Jess that he and his dad wanted to get some amazing graduation pictures on Dolly Sods. Since Tucker County is such a special place to them, she decided to tag along for some pictures of just the two of them. Perfect!

Jess and Matt are just adorable!! On our drive up together to Dolly Sods, I learned all about their sweet story. They have been together for about a year and a half. According to Matt’s Dad, they’re just made for each other. It was so fun knowing what was about to unfold riding in the car with them as we made the trip together up the mountain.

After the small trek down windy West Virginia roads and up the mountain, we made it to one of their favorite overlooks. It may have been only 40 degrees with some snow flurries and sunshine, but I knew what an epic moment this would be. The wind was INSANE! We couldn’t really hear each other and I said a quick prayer that it would calm down enough for me to give them a little bit of direction before he got down on one knee… Somehow all the elements aligned. Matt pulled out the most gorgeous Tiffany ring, and Jess was shocked. She had no idea!!! The sun and clouds were just right, even with the wind, it was AMAZING!! Some of my favorite shots I’ve ever taken.

He even had Thomasyard make her a bouquet of her favorite flowers, yellow roses! My heart was exploding with joy for them.

The rest of our time together, Jess just kept saying “I still am just in shock! How did you do this?!”

 

Congratulations, again you guys!! What an honor it was to photograph this amazing time in your life!! Happy wedding planning!
